Around 100 tall ships from 15 to 20 countries will sail next year from Waterford in Ireland to Halmstad, in Sweden, via Greenock, Lerwick and Stavanger.
Sail Training International, which organises the event, is looking for young people aged 15 to 25 to crew the spectacular vessels when they come to Scotland.
Individuals can decide for themselves which leg they would like to take part in.
They can choose to race or perhaps join the cruise in company, sailing from Greenock to Lerwick, when ships have the option of visiting the guest ports of Campbeltown, Port Ellen and Oban, among others, on their way up the west coast of Scotland.
